Job Description
Visa is seeking an experienced technical leader to design, develop, enhance, and deliver the next-generation security technologies to maintain trust in the Visa brand, ensure the safety, soundness and integrity of the Visa payment system, and prevent operational losses to Visa and its clients. This includes idea generation, architecture, design, development, and testing of novel security technologies. The Vice President (VP) of Cybersecurity Product Engineering will also evaluate and improve on existing Visa security solutions, always seeking to reduce friction while increasing security, integrity, and trust. The right candidate will also be adept at engaging with partners within the business to identify gaps and drive adoption of security solutions. The VP of Cybersecurity Product Engineering will be an experienced leader, capable of leading teams working on multiple disparate projects and driving to product delivery.
Essential Functions
Defines the direction for research (R&D), engineering within cybersecurity, within the context of the overall Cybersecurity and Technology strategy
Drives decisions with significant impact on the overall Cybersecurity Maturity and success metrics
Interacts internally and externally with thought leaders across regions, requiring influencing skills
Applies creative thinking/approach to determine solutions that further Business Goals and align with Technology Strategies
Ability to communicate on cybersecurity topics to diverse audiences, from new-hire engineers to senior executives and customers
Capability to conduct original research, or guide the research of colleagues, in order to solve complex problems through empirical methods and experimentation
Demonstrate technical mastery and be an inspirational leader and mentor who continuously develops the competencies of their self and others.
